Fun facts about Taiwan for kids
- Taiwan was the first place in the world to offer free public Wi-Fi on a massive scale!
- Taipei 101 was the tallest building in the world until 2010 and has a giant pendulum inside to stop earthquakes!
- The island produces a massive amount of the world's most advanced computer chips!
- Night markets are incredible, busy streets full of games, shopping, and amazing street food.
- Bubble tea (boba) was invented here in the 1980s and is now famous worldwide!
